You need to remove the battery before you insert the UIM.
⇒
See page 42
The UIM is an IC card that holds your information such as phone numbers. It can hold data such as the
Phonebook entries and SMS messages as well. By replacing the UIM, you can operate multiple FOMA
phones for multiple purposes.
You cannot use the FOMA phone for transmission such as voice and video-phone calls, i-mode,
sending/receiving mail, or packet transmission unless the UIM is inserted.
Refer to the UIM manual for details about how to use it.
When inserting or removing the UIM, take care not to accidentally touch or scratch the IC.

Make sure that you insert/remove the UIM with the FOMA phone closed and held in your hand after you turn off the power.
●
Make sure that the tray for the UIM is not drawn out when attaching the battery. If the tray is drawn out, the battery cannot be
attached. Note that the UIM or tray may be damaged if the battery is forcibly attached.
●
Take care not to force the UIM into place because this can break it.
●
Take care not to lose the UIM once you remove it.
